Well, yes, I answer back: friends are friends not for purely objective reasons; we have friends because they bring us pleasure. Is it selfish to have friends? Indeed.<br \/>\nHe suggests friends help us to establish who we are ourselves, and asks if many of us is strong enough to have a solid sense of ourselves without others.<br \/>\nThis from La Rochefoucauld, whose gnomic statements can penetrated deeply into the human heart: &#8220;However rare true love may be, it is less so than true friendship.&#8221;<br \/>\nChp 6 is an &#8220;extremely sketchy history of friendship.&#8221; It is that: it has a bit of a survey and then wanders, as familiar essays are wont to do, into a few topics in that history in the last half of the chp.<br \/>\nOne issue: he claims Christianity devalues friendship because it elevates love of all and love of enemies.  Friendship is an exclusive and excluding type of thing; it is discriminatory; it chooses some to spend time with; it is not as spontaneous. Etc.<br \/>\nDo you think Christianity minimizes what is meant by friendship in the classical sense of that word?
